What is common cold? Surprisingly, there are not too many people who make the difference between common cold and influenza. Common cold is and inflammation that occurs in the respiratory tract and in most cases it is caused by a viral infection. This is an issue that affects people during cold seasons. Because viruses cause inflammation of the respiratory tract, there are some symptoms that occur. The most common symptoms of this illness are sneezing, runny nose, blocked nose, tearing, sore throat, headaches and cough.

Specialists believe that common cold symptoms are caused by an impressive number of viruses. Corona viruses, echoviruses, syncytial virus, influenza A and B viruses, rhino viruses and also parainfluenza viruses are only few of the viruses that can cause common cold symptoms. In order to find an effective treatment for these symptoms, specialists should find an anti-viral that kills hundreds of viruses. Yes, here we are talking about hundreds, not only about the viruses that I mentioned above. However, neither an anti-viral would be an effective treatment. Many people think that if they take medicines they can get rid of the common cold symptoms. Well, they have to understand that the cold disappears by itself.
